Select Brand:

Show All


£16.35

Dispatch on next business day

£64.93

Dispatch on next business day

£2.02

Dispatch on next business day

£51.58

Dispatch on next business day

£84.04

Dispatch on next business day

£48.61

Dispatch on next business day

£2.30

Dispatch on next business day

£34.05

Dispatch on next business day

£53.05

Dispatch on next business day

£32.93

Dispatch on next business day

£60.89

Dispatch on next business day

£42.79

Dispatch on next business day